Transaction cdcb64cece5be39d15675bd72ad67ea3a8ad15be315dfdfd101bc9c7af1d879f
2 Input
2 Outputs
- cdcb64cece5be39d15675bd72ad67ea3a8ad15be315dfdfd101bc9c7af1d879f:0
- cdcb64cece5be39d15675bd72ad67ea3a8ad15be315dfdfd101bc9c7af1d879f:1
value 17102730
address 1JbAstw5euKfdUmD6jEzy6x2Apf6NF8ShM
value 12583845
address 1KCfqDTERk4Zi8LHUhyttK6MCgvVUDuLAM